TROUBLE SHOOTING
Problem Possible Cause Possible Solution
Terminal will not turn on DC power adapter not connected
properly.
User disabled the Auto “On” Mode.
Connect the DC power adapter
Press the power button for 2
seconds to power up the
terminal. Use LaunchPad to
enable the Auto “On” Mode.
Battery does not charge Battery is defective (battery LED is
flashing red)
Battery temperature is outside charging
range
Replace battery
Battery will only be charged at
temperatures between 0°C and
45°C.
Cannot insert battery
into terminal
Battery incorrectly oriented Ensure the battery is oriented as
shown in First Time Setup
Cannot insert USIM card
holder into terminal
USIM is not correctly seated in the card
holder
Card holder incorrectly oriented
Ensure the USIM is pressed firmly
into the card holder
Ensure the card holder is
oriented as shown in First Time
Setup
